Good evening,

I recently bought a refurbished Macbook Pro 2015 15" 2.8 GHz 256 GB. Now I found out that this Macbook Pro has a failure on its mainboard which leads to problems with its graphic unit and the USB ports. The shop where I bought it gave me the choice to replace the Macbook Pro 2015 for the identical model or to choose a 2018 15" MacBook Pro 2.2 GHz in a used look but technically perfect for some more money.
I searched for advice which Macbook to choose on google where I found a lot of criticism still on the 2018 keyboard. I don't know anyone who owns a 2018 Macbook, so I can only conclude from the rumors that the prabability that a failure occurs on the keyboard is pretty high.
I am a student working a lot with coding e.g. with MATLAB/Simulink where I run a lot of dynamic models. Also, I work a lot on optimization which comes along with very long calculations with high processor load.
Now I wanted to ask for your advice. Would you rather choose the 2015 model again or would you upgrade to the newer 2018 model?
I'd be very interested especially on your own experience with the 2018 model according to the rumors that already very small particles can cause problems with the keyboard. Also if the heat development of the CPU and GPU can cause problems with the keyboard as well.

Thank you very much for your advice!

I had the 2017 MBP 13". I kept the keyboard covered to prevent the dust under the keys issue. I never had any problems with it. The 2018 was supposed to have a membrane installed that was supposed to keep the dust out and prevent the issue.

If the shop offers a warranty of at least a year I would go with the 2018 and put a clear cover on the keyboard. It is not ideal but you could also use an external keyboard with it. Also it should have better performance.

I just bought the 2020 MBP 13" to get the new keyboard and I will say it is much nicer than the one on my 2017. The feel is sooo much better.

It might also be good to check out the apple refurbished store. That will give you a price comparison and they do come with one year of AppleCare.

I would avoid both the 2015 and 2018 for different reasons. Good advice from Lisa regarding the Apple refurbished store. Some 2019 16" MacBook Pro models have appeared in the refurb store. Or you might want to spend the money on a new 13" 2020 model.

Also keep in mind that Apple is switching its architecture from Intel to ARM with the first models appearing in 2021. Do some reading on that and then make an informed decision on what to buy.
